Psychodynamic Theorist
An individual who studies or advocates for the psychodynamic approach, focusing on the psychological forces that underlie human behavior, feelings, and emotions.
Principle of Falsifiability
A criterion for scientific theory validity, suggesting that for a theory to be considered scientific, it must be testable and potentially disprovable.
Retrospective Accounts
Retrospective accounts are narratives or explanations of past events or experiences, often analyzed or interpreted after the fact.
Adult Memories
The recollection of experiences and information that individuals accumulate and store throughout their adult life.
